Catholic Archbishop of the Metropolitan See of Lagos, Alfred Martins, has called on Nigerians to seek divine guidance in their quest for peace this year to ensure it is free from chaos and anarchy.
While admitting that Nigerians went through very turbulent times in 2022, Martins noted that the country needed God-fearing leaders that will wipe away tears from the citizens’ face. “President Muhammadu Buhari has pledged to ensure that we have credible elections. I do not doubt that he means well. But he cannot do it all alone. We must all play our part by ensuring that we come out to vote for the right candidates and make sure our votes count. That is a way of ensuring that our elections would be credible.”
